Transaction 7768606f498994672f30d5c43d6b45e73f80792beb646a1d0f0e255685707b6c

1 Input
2 Outputs
  • 7768606f498994672f30d5c43d6b45e73f80792beb646a1d0f0e255685707b6c:0
  • value  5792588
    address  3QBQVSZsdyBYQNfdQ4hPY8og4NrNvKS8Jo
  • 7768606f498994672f30d5c43d6b45e73f80792beb646a1d0f0e255685707b6c:1
  • value  77071063
    address  3H7bhJnfmbkXykibpphi1ixkfky6Rzudms